ABOUT THE JOB YOU'RE CONSIDERING
Capgemini is seeking an AWS EKS Infra / DevOps Lead to drive the design, implementation, and management of scalable cloud infrastructure and DevOps practices on AWS. This role requires strong expertise in EKS/Kubernetes, CI/CD pipeline development, and Infrastructure as Code (IaC).
As a DevOps Lead, you will be responsible for ensuring reliable, secure, and high-performing cloud environments while guiding automation strategies and deployment processes. You will collaborate closely with development teams to build cloud-ready architectures, enhance system resilience, and implement DevOps best practices to accelerate delivery and operational efficiency.

What Employers Look For
The qualifications that appear most often in devops lead jobs.
- Five or more years of experience in DevOps, SRE, or platform engineering roles
- Hands-on expertise with at least one major cloud provider such as AWS, Azure, or GCP
- Proficiency with CI/CD tooling including Jenkins, GitHub Actions, or GitLab CI
- Experience with containerization and orchestration using Docker and Kubernetes
- Strong scripting skills in Python, Bash, or Go for automation and tooling
- Relevant certifications such as AWS Certified DevOps Engineer or Certified Kubernetes Administrator
Tips for Your Devops Lead Job Search
Quantify your pipeline impact concretely
Recruiters screening devops lead resumes look for outcomes, not responsibilities. Replace phrases like 'managed CI/CD pipelines' with specifics: deployment frequency improvements, mean time to recovery reductions, or infrastructure cost changes you drove directly.
Show cross-functional leadership on your resume
Devops lead roles require influencing developers, security, and product teams without direct authority. Highlight moments where you drove adoption of a tool or process across teams, not just within your own squad.
Filter openings by your cloud platform depth
Job listings for devops leads often require hands-on expertise in AWS, Azure, or GCP rather than general cloud familiarity. Target roles that match the platform where you have the deepest production experience to avoid screening gaps.

Prepare a systems-design story for interviews
Devops lead interviews often include a live whiteboard or discussion of a past architecture decision. Walk through one real example of a platform you designed or overhauled, including the constraints, tradeoffs, and what you'd do differently.
Negotiate scope, not just compensation
When evaluating an offer, clarify team size, on-call expectations, and whether you'll own the roadmap or execute one defined above you. These factors affect day-to-day experience more than title and are negotiable before you sign.

How do you become a devops lead?
You become a devops lead by building deep hands-on experience across the full software delivery lifecycle, then taking on progressively broader ownership. Start by mastering CI/CD, cloud infrastructure, and monitoring at the individual contributor level. From there, lead incident response, mentor junior engineers, and drive adoption of tooling or process improvements across teams. Demonstrating that you can align engineering practices to business outcomes is what moves you from senior engineer to lead.
Can I get hired as a devops lead without prior lead experience?
You can get hired as a devops lead without a prior lead title if you can demonstrate equivalent scope in your current role. Focus your application on concrete examples of owning a platform or pipeline end-to-end, mentoring others, and making architectural decisions rather than just executing them. Smaller companies and high-growth startups are more likely to promote based on demonstrated capability than formal leadership history.
What does the devops lead interview process look like?
The devops lead interview process typically includes a recruiter screen, a technical phone round covering infrastructure and tooling knowledge, a systems design or architecture discussion where you walk through a past platform decision, and a leadership or behavioral round focused on cross-team collaboration and incident management. Some companies add a take-home exercise or live coding component involving scripting or pipeline configuration. Final rounds often include a conversation with engineering leadership about roadmap ownership and team structure.
